Laser Innovation in Dermatology
Laser treatments work by delivering focused light energy to target and break down undesirable pigment in the skin. Over the past couple of years, laser technology has evolved significantly, offering more accurate and effective treatments with reduced recovery times.

Q: How do novel laser technologies, such as fractional lasers and picosecond lasers, work for treating acne? A:
• Fractional lasers: These lasers create tiny columns of ablated tissue within the skin, promoting collagen production and skin resurfacing. This can be especially beneficial for treating acne scars and hyperpigmentation.
• Picosecond lasers: These lasers provide picosecond-duration pulses of light, permitting more targeted treatment of melanin-rich acne lesions and lessening the threat of negative effects.
